Join us for an insightful webinar that explores the growing need for Clinical Documentation Integrity (CDI) Specialists and the ongoing advancement in artificial intelligence (AI). Our experts will explore key features of the AGS AI Platform, emphasizing the importance of automation in both inpatient (IP) and outpatient (OP) workflows to alleviate the query process. We will demonstrate the benefits of Computer-Assisted CDI, providing a practical framework to transform clinical documentation practices and capture the true clinical picture of each patient.
Our session will feature real-world applications of CDI and how these advancements can support various collaborative roles within your healthcare organization, from Chief Financial Officers to Chief Medical Officers to coding teams.
